    Hey Janelylm - thanks for your comment! I recommend keeping all costs (tuition and living expenses) at the 1:1 level. Graduating with 80k of tuition debt plus $40k of additional 'living expense' debt still means you have $120k of student loans. Paying $120k of student loans on a 70k-80k salary is very challenging. You can see the video of the top 10 cheapest PT schools to find that it is possible to graduate with less than 80-100k of total student debt. Some students have even moved to a different state, lived there a year to gain residency, then applied to a cheaper school. It's possible, but it's not easy.
